PER CURIAM:

Samuel A. Lyons appeals the magistrate judge’s order granting Ileen M. Ticer

Greene’s motion to dismiss Lyons’ amended complaint. * We have reviewed the record

and find no reversible error. Accordingly, we affirm the magistrate judge’s order. Lyons v.

PMA Indem. Ins., No. 1:23-cv-00359-ADC (D. Md. July 11, 2023). We dispense with oral

argument because the facts and legal contentions are adequately presented in the materials

before this court and argument would not aid the decisional process.

AFFIRMED

* The parties consented to the magistrate judge’s jurisdiction pursuant to

28 U.S.C. § 636

(c).
